comparison doc/PCM-file-formats @ 152:a217a6eacbad

doc/PCM-file-formats: establish "robe" format
author Mychaela Falconia <falcon@freecalypso.org>
date Wed, 14 Dec 2022 22:40:31 +0000
parents 195911f2211c
children
comparison
equal deleted inserted replaced
151:a13b1605142b 152:a217a6eacbad
14 pcm16-raw2wav converts from raw format to WAV 14 pcm16-raw2wav converts from raw format to WAV
15 pcm16-wav2raw converts from WAV to raw format 15 pcm16-wav2raw converts from WAV to raw format
16 16
17 Both utilities take a mandatory command line argument specifying the endian 17 Both utilities take a mandatory command line argument specifying the endian
18 order for the raw format - there is no default. 18 order for the raw format - there is no default.
19
20 Going forward, I (Mother Mychaela) prefer big-endian format for raw PCM16 files:
21 aside from it being the network byte order on the Internet, 16-bit and 32-bit
22 numbers appear "naturally" in hex dumps in BE, but not in LE. Therefore, newly
23 developed utilities will read and write PCM16 data in "robe" format - "robe" is
24 English pronunciation play on "raw BE", and it is also the ritual garment worn
25 by Themyscira telecom priestesses. :-)